Identifying Forms
When attending the course, it is crucial that you bring 3 identification forms with you as evidence to get you enrolled into the course on that day. You will have to bring 1 from Class A:

Passport (Signed, Current, Valid)

UK Birth Certificate (issued within 12 month of birth)

A driving licence photocard and its paper counterpart issued by the Driver and Vehicle Agency (DVA) in Northern Ireland

UK Biometric Residence Permit Card
After you have made sure you have selected 1 from the above documents, you will be required to bring 2 documents from Class B below this text:

Bank or building society statement from the last 3 months (we will accept 2 statements, but only if they are from different banks or building societies)

A utility bill from the last 3 months (no phone bills)

A credit card statement from the last 3 months (we will accept 2 statements, but only if they are from different credit-card providers)

A council tax statement from the last 12 months

A mortgage statement from the last 12 months

A driving licence photocard issued by the DVA in Northern Ireland (not the paper counterpart)

A pension, endowment or ISA statement from the last 12 months

A P45 or P60 tax statement from the last 12 months
A letter from the last 3 months from any of the following:
